Chief Minister Bhupendra Patel invites US Consul General David Ranz to Gujarat Vibrant Summit, and US firms to Defence Expo
Even as 120 US companies are working in Gujarat, Chief Minister looks forward for more industries under Atmanirbhar Bharat
US envoy express desire for more bilateral relation with Gujarat in higher education, social empowerment, climate change
Gandhinagar, Saturday: United State of America Consul General David Ranz in Mumbai, representing western zone including Gujarat and Maharashtra, paid a courtesy call on Gujarat Chief Minister Bhupendra Patel here today.
Mr. Ranz had earlier visited the Statue of Unity (SOU) at Kevadiya, Vadodara and Ahmedabad before meeting Mr. Patel here.
Giving an idea of the SOU, Mr. Patel said it is the world’s tallest statue as envisioned by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, now drawing a large number of domestic as well as international tourists to the site, humming with activity providing jobs to many local people.
Mr. Patel apprised the visiting envoy about scope of greater US participation in Gujarat’s ongoing big-ticket projects like 30,000 MW Hybrid Energy Park in Kutch, GIFT City being developed as a Banking and Financial Hub.
The Chief Minister extended invitation to Mr. Ranz to the forthcoming Gujarat Government’s biennial flagship event Vibrant Summit and invite to US companies to participate in Defence Expo in March 2022.
He said that 120 USA companies are working in Gujarat, and expressed his desire to strengthen bilateral relation between Gujarat and the USA in trade and economic matters, set up new industries as semiconductor. Gujarat has received USD 11.36 billion FDI.
Mr. Ranz thanked Mr. Patel for Gujarat Government’s positive approach and evinced interest for more US participation and cooperation in higher education, social empowerment, meet challenges in climate change.
